Role description
Remote job, North American hours, but this can be somewhat flexible. VISA SPONSORSHIP IS NOT AVAILABLE The Analytics Engineer will design, build, and maintain scalable data pipelines and models that power marketing analytics and reporting. This role bridges data engineering and analytics, ensuring marketing teams have reliable, well-structured data to drive strategic decisions, optimize campaigns, and integrate marketing technology tools. Top skills: • SQL • Building/maintaining data warehouse experience • Data modeling Technical Tools / Applications: • Strong SQL/Snowflake is a must • Power BI experience nice to have • Scripting/coding is nice to have • GitHub is nice to have • Claude proficiency is nice to have Key Responsibilities: Data Strategy & Architecture • Develop and maintain a unified marketing data warehouse (e.g., Snowflake, BigQuery) to ensure reliability, performance, and accessibility. • Define and implement best practices for data ingestion, transformation, and governance. • Align KPIs and metrics to marketing and business objectives for consistent reporting across tools and dashboards. Marketing Tool Integration • Integrate data from MarTech platforms (e.g., Marketo, Salesforce, Adobe) into centralized data systems. • Work with engineering to build automated pipelines using tools like Fivetran, dbt, and Git for version control and deployment. • Ensure data consistency and completeness across marketing systems and analytics platforms. Analytics Enablement • Collaborate with marketing, sales, and finance teams to deliver actionable insights through dashboards and reports. • Support advanced analytics use cases such as attribution modeling, campaign performance analysis, and customer segmentation. • Implement continuous improvement practices for marketing data processes and reporting. Data Quality & Governance • Establish and enforce data quality standards (accuracy, timeliness, consistency). • Maintain documentation for data definitions, taxonomies, and standardized KPIs across analytics tools. Required Skills & Tools: • Strong SQL and experience with data modeling frameworks. • Proficiency in cloud data warehouses (Snowflake, BigQuery). • Familiarity with marketing analytics tools (Marketo, Salesforce, Google Analytics, Power BI). • Knowledge of version control (Git). • Understanding of marketing metrics (ROI, CLV, attribution, funnel analysis). Preferred Qualifications • Experience in marketing analytics or supporting marketing operations. • Ability to translate complex data concepts into actionable insights for non-technical stakeholders. • Familiarity with predictive and prescriptive analytics techniques for marketing optimization.
